These gaps in unexpected emergency savings are notably relevant in light-weight in the COVID-19 pandemic and involved occupation losses. Since the 2019 SCF details were being collected just prior to the onset with the pandemic, these gaps in financial savings advise big disparities in family members' power to weather the pandemic. In truth, Bhutta, Blair, Dettling, and Moore (2020) realize that without the considerable dollars assistance included in the Coronavirus Support, Aid, and Economic Stability (CARES) Act, there can be significant disparities by race and ethnicity while in the share of households who could cover their typical, recurring expenditures when they were being to lose their career for six months or more.15 They discover that just ten percent of Hispanic families and 14 per cent of Black family members have sufficient savings to deal with six months of charges, as compared to 36 % of White family members and 27 % of other families.

Lifestyle-cycle styles of homeownership by age and by race and ethnicity are similar to the styles of wealth (Figure 3). Homeownership rises sharply from youthful to middle-age in spite of race or ethnicity. At the same time, in just Each and every age team you'll find sizeable gaps in homeownership amongst White and non-White people, with the greatest gaps concerning White and Black households.

People usually purpose to construct up quickly-obtainable cost savings that will help cope with sudden charges and disruptions for their revenue. While interest charges on remarkably-liquid transaction accounts are generally very minimal and, Subsequently, these extremely-liquid accounts are less important for very long-term wealth-creating than increased-return belongings like housing or retirement accounts, financial savings may help households prevent costly borrowing or missed payments when surprising gatherings arise.
